High quality rabbit fur features a uniform and refined fiber structure that forms the foundation of its premium performance. Strict fiber screening removes over-coarse guard hairs, underdeveloped thin fibers and irregular fiber clusters, retaining dense, evenly arranged fine underfur. This consistent fiber composition creates a smooth, velvety and uniform surface without patchy roughness or uneven fluff thickness. Compared with ordinary rabbit fur, the refined fiber layout eliminates random friction points, delivering reliable skin-friendly softness and consistent tactile experience across the entire material surface.
Superior structural stability and anti-shedding performance are iconic traits of high quality rabbit fur. Through professional high-temperature fiber locking and layered carding processes, internal fiber clusters are firmly fixed to prevent loose hair loss, a common flaw in low-grade fur. The integrated fiber structure maintains complete fluff integrity during daily friction, cutting processing and routine cleaning. It avoids matting, fluff collapse and sparse fiber gaps that gradually appear on generic rabbit fur, ensuring long-term structural completeness and neat appearance of finished products.
Standardized color fastness and anti-fading capability further define its high-grade positioning. High quality rabbit fur adopts low-temperature physical dyeing and neutral color fixation technology, which penetrates pigment evenly into fiber structures rather than relying on superficial color coating. This processing method resists color bleeding, fading and tonal dulling caused by light exposure, air oxidation and gentle washing. Whether used for long-term indoor placement or outdoor casual wear, the fur maintains uniform, saturated and natural color tones without patchy discoloration.
Balanced thermal and breathable performance ensures comprehensive practicality. High quality rabbit fur retains the natural micro-pore structure of organic fibers, forming stable air insulation layers for mild, lightweight warmth. Meanwhile, orderly fiber gaps enable passive air circulation, preventing the stuffiness and moisture accumulation that plague dense low-quality fur. This scientific balance of insulation and breathability adapts to dynamic daily wearing states, providing comfortable thermal regulation for transitional seasons and mild winter environments.
